Ralph Ellison, On Work In Progress

Duration: 30

Year Published: 1966

Creator: NET SCIENCE PRISM PRODUCTION

Format: 16mm

Description: Reveals a candid portrait of Ralph Ellison, author of "The Invisible Man}." Presents Ellison discussing the function of the writer in society, how he came to write "The Invisible Man": his own involvement with the work, and how he feels a work of art should engage all of a writer's being. Features the author reading from this work and commenting on the contribution which the Negro church has made to the eloquence of most Negro writers.
